Istiglal anti-materiel rifle
The İstiglal IST-14.5 anti-materiel rifle is a recoil-operated, semi-automatic anti-materiel sniper rifle produced by Telemexanika zavodu, subsidiary of the Ministry of Defence Industry of Azerbaijan.
The Istiglal is chambered for the 14.5×114mm round.
History
Although developed in 2008, it was only revealed in 2009 during the International Defense Exhibition Fair. Its appearance has attracted a huge number of visitors.It has been exported to the Turkish Armed Forces and the Pakistan Armed Forces.

Mübariz (''Fighter'')
This weapon is named after Mubariz Ibrahimov, the National Hero of Azerbaijan. It is a 12.7×108mm version of the Istiglal 14.5mm anti-materiel sniper rifle introduced by the Ministry of Defense Industry of Azerbaijan. The 12.7mm Mubariz sniper rifle is much lighter in comparison to the Istiglal at 15 kg with a five-round magazine.Users

In April 2011, Mechanical and Chemical Industry Corporation announced that sniper rifle, which will be produced jointly, will differ much from the model that is being tested in Azerbaijan. Changes will be made in the design, weight and some systems of the weapon. The production of IST-12.7 sniper rifle in Turkey is the first military production transfer of Azerbaijan.
